Swim coach Dennis Hill celebrates 1,000 wins

February 8, 2013 AAPS News Editor
Pioneer swim coach Dennis Hill was honored with a celebration of his career on Thursday night, comprising 1,000 wins and 31 state titles over 45 years. He sent out this thank-you today:

AAPS Tuition Preschool Open Houses coming up in March

February 4, 2013 AAPS News Editor
The Ann Arbor Public Schools Rec & Ed offers tuition preschools at Allen and Thurston Elementary. Students who are age four by 12/1/2013 are welcome.
